is a city at the frontier of Bohemia and Moravia in the Bohemian-Moravian Highlands of the . It is in the centre of the protected landscape area of Zdarske Vrchy.

is a town in the Bohemian-Moravian Highlands of the . It has 10,464 inhabitants. Near , there is a test facility of EGU Brno.
